    While there may be no written Persian record of the Manticor, there is a carved rock stela with a very manticor like creature. I believe it's one of king Darius's victory reliefs and it shows him tusseling with a lion that i believe has a scorpion tail. Now the creature in the picture is supposed to represent Darius's victory over the many rebellious cities that cropped up after his rise to power

      @@NickLavic I prefer my manticores wingless as well, but "wrong" is pretty subjective when it comes to mythical creatures. The very first descriptions of the manticore probably bear little resemblance to the "correct" image you have of them, and I'm sure there were hundreds of differing accounts, no one of which was more valid than the other. For example, my image of a manticore depicted "correctly" involves not a scorpion's tail, but a tail ending in a morning-star-like array of venomous spines that it shoots at its prey.
      As with all monsters, the manticore's description has varied and evolved from teller to teller, and that tradition continues even to today. To suggest that at some arbitrary point it became a _true_ manticore and that any description that diverges from that one (whether it came before or after) is foolish.

    The manticore appeared in several Fighting Fantasy gamebooks - Creature of Havoc (1986), Deathtrap Dungeon (1984), Knights of Doom (1994), Legend of the Shadow Warriors (1991), Stormslayer (2009), and The Shamutanti Hills (1983). It was also in d20 ttrpg module of the same title in 2003. As for Advanced Fighting Fantasy ttrpg, it was mentioned in Beyond the Pits (2014), Out of the Pit (1985, later reedited and republished in 2011), and Return to the Pit (2019). It was also in video games Steve Jackson’s Sorcery! Part 1 and 2.
    Author Neil Gaiman used the manticore in his writings such as The Books of Magic (1990) and Unnatural Creatures (2013).
    In Smite video game, the Manticore was used as an AI opponent for players to practice on. In 2023 they brought in a new playable character as a part of the Greek pantheon named Martichoras the Manticore King.

    I also wonder sometimes if that first Greek writer struggled with translation and unusual words - or if the people telling him stories about wildlife were struggling. Of course the prankster angle is very possible too - "hey let's tell this silly foreigner a story, how ridiculous a creature can we get him to believe in?" But what if they were struggling to describe the sudden attack of the tiger? I've seen footage of the way the big cats can lunge, especially since they favor ambush tactics. If you got lucky and the cat's claws "only" grazed you - you could be forgiven for thinking someone had thrown javelins or spikes at you! And given how filthy cat claws are (no matter what kind of cat), I bet plenty of people DID die from such wounds due to infection... leading to the logical enough assumption that the monster's weaponry is poisoned.
    There's also the possibility that someone tried to draw a picture of the tiger and was not exactly a professional artist, haha. But we'd have little way to know, since a "back of the envelope" quick doodle or sketch wouldn't be preserved!
